Search and Organize Chats
Over time, many chats accumulate. Ayunis Core provides features to quickly find conversations and keep them organized.
Chats in the Sidebar
Section titled “Chats in the Sidebar”All your chats appear in the left sidebar, sorted by the date of the last message – the newest are at the top.
Click on a chat to open it and continue working there.

Searching Chats
Section titled “Searching Chats”- Click the search field at the top of the sidebar
- Enter a search term (e.g., “building permit” or “minutes”)
- The list automatically filters to matching chats
The search looks through chat titles. That’s why it’s helpful to give your chats meaningful titles.
Filtering Chats by Skill
Section titled “Filtering Chats by Skill”If you know which skill you used:
- Use the filter at the top of the search page
- Select the desired skill
- Only chats with that skill will be displayed
Tips for Good Organization
Section titled “Tips for Good Organization”| Tip | Example |
|---|---|
| Give meaningful titles | ”Response Citizen Inquiry Waste Fees” instead of “Chat 1” |
| Regularly clean up old chats | Delete conversations you no longer need |
| One topic per chat | Start a new chat for new tasks |
| Save important results | Copy finished texts to your files before deleting the chat |
Practical Example
Section titled “Practical Example”You created a draft for an invitation letter last week and want to adjust it. Enter “invitation letter” in the search – the matching chat appears immediately in the list.
